How this list is built. Bespoke Grants indexes 13M+ grants from public IRS Form 990 filings. This page shows foundations whose giving carries a documented civil rights & social justice focus and that have funded Missouri nonprofits. Giving figures reflect each funder's total recent grants to Missouri recipients. IRS data publishes on a 1–2 year lag; figures are current through the most recent available filings.
